A train travels at a speed of 85 miles per hour. How far will it travel in 4 hours?

Mathematics
2 answers:
True [87]3 years ago
8 0
85 x 4 = 340
Because distance is speed times time

Evaluate the function g(x) = 8x+16 when x=-3,0, and 8
andriy [413]

Answer:

g(x)=8x+16 for x= -3, 0, and 8.

g(-3) = -8

g(0)= 16

g(8)= 80

Step-by-step explanation:

Step 1. Plugin the given numbers.

g(-3)= 8(-3) + 16

g(0)= 8(0) + 16

g(8)= 8(8) + 16

Step 2. Solve the equations.

g(-3)= -24 + 16   Multiplied -3 and 8.

g(-3)= -8             Added -24 and 16

g(0)= 0+16         Multiplied 0 and 8.

g(0)= 16             Added 16 and 0.

g(8)= 64+16      Multiplied 8 and 8.

g(8)= 80            Added 64 and 16.
